- Simple Cambridgeshire farm campsite 15 minutes’ drive from Royston
- Imperial War Museum Duxford and Cambridge both half an hour’s drive
- Peaceful grass pitches with hot showers available; livestock on site

Liked Quiet site with views over a field of sheep, reasonably priced for a tent pitch. Nice sized pitch separated by longer grass.
Disliked Facilities weren’t great - only one loo had soap, very low loo roll supplies. Pipe leaking in one of the cubicles, both loos a bit manky, shower was not clean at all. Washing up station was cold water only. I reported the leaking pipe and the contact given said ‘thank you’ but nothing was done about it.

Liked Its a nice simple camping site with generous sized level pitches. Facilities (2 toilets, 1 shower and a washing machine are more than adequate for the 10 pitches. There is no through traffic so children can play safely. The couple running it seemed very helpful and friendly. Located on a working farm.
Disliked The road, whilst just a B road, is nevertheless used quite regularly in the morning and evening and the noise is quite intrusive as cars are going quite fast.
